> I have tried opening the file in DT 2.4.4 (Debian)
> 
> [rawspeed] (DSC_5978.NEF) void
> rawspeed::HuffmanTable::setCodeValues(const rawspeed::Buffer&), line
> 176: Corrupt Huffman. Code value 92 is bigger than 16
> 
> [temperature] failed to read camera white balance information from
> `DSC_5978.NEF'!
> 
> From OS:
> $ file /tmp/DSC_5978.NEF
> /tmp/DSC_5978.NEF: TIFF image data, little-endian, direntries=28,
> height=120, bps=352, compression=none, PhotometricIntepretation=RGB,
> manufacturer=NIKON CORPORATION, model=NIKON D750,
> orientation=upper-left, width=160
> 
> One of my raw files:
> $ file Pictures/2018-06-20/DSC_1685.NEF
> Pictures/2018-06-20/DSC_1685.NEF: TIFF image data, big-endian,
> direntries=28, height=0, bps=0, compression=none,
> PhotometricIntepretation=RGB, manufacturer=NIKON CORPORATION,
> model=NIKON D600, orientation=upper-left, width=0
> 
> See the difference: DSC_5978.NEF: little-endian vs DSC_1685.NEF:
> big-endian
> 
> Seems for some reason DT fails if raw file is having little-endianess.

but the d750 was a motorola chip and is big-endian
my d500 is an intell chip and little-endian
